There are 3 different 3-6-9 Medical Medium cleanses (original, simplified and advanced) that focus on clearing out toxins and pathogens from your liver (as well as the rest of your body). They can be referenced in more detail in Cleanse to Heal and Liver Rescue, where the original 3-6-9 was born. 

3-6-9 cleanses are 9 days long and structured into three 3 day increments where you gradually rev up and detox your liver culminating in a huge release on the final day of the cleanse. These cleanses are an amazingly powerful way to safely unearth long buried and stored toxins in your liver creating newfound vitality in all domains of your health.

The Simplified 3-6-9 is 70% as powerful as the original and is easier to accomplish. It is especially designed for “high cholesterol, high blood pressure, fatty liver, arterial plaque, lymphedema, arthritis, insomnia, varicose veins, dark under-eye circles, acid reflux, constipation, IBS, dry skin, type 2 diabetes, headaches, migraines and so much more.” (p. 89 Cleanse to Heal)

Guidelines

For meals of your choice:

  • Avoid radical fats (nuts, seeds, oils, olives, coconut, avocado, cacao, bone broth, animal proteins) and beans. 
  • Avoid eggs, dairy, gluten, soft drinks, salt and seasonings, pork, corn, all oils (even healthy ones), soy, lamb, tuna, fish and seafood, all vinegars, caffeine (including coffee, matcha and chocolate), all grains, alcohol, fermented foods, nutritional yeast, citric acid, MSG, aspartame, other artificial sweeteners, formaldehyde and preservatives
  • Ideally, stick with fruits, vegetables, leafy greens and millet or oats if desired. Here are some recipe options.
  • Steam, don’t roast for your vegetables.
  • If you need substitutions, refer to Chapter 21 Cleanse to Heal
  • For all meals, eat portions that satiate you.
  • Snack when you are hungry on apples or applesauce. You do not want to be hungry.
